BAPE Drops Pair of Graphic Tees for Cherry Blossom Season
Springtime means sakura.
BAPE is back with more seasonal goods, after introducing the 1ST CAMO shoulder bag yesterday. This time, the label is introducing a pair of graphic shirts in time for the resurgence of cherry blossoms in Japan. The “SAKURA APE HEAD PHOTO TEE” and “SAKURA COLLEGE TEE” each draw upon established BAPE imagery: the former places a photo of a person wearing a Shark Hoodie in front of Mt. Fuji inside of the infamous Ape Head silhouette, while the latter offers a smattering of pink cherry blossoms around classic BAPE branding. Both graphics are offered on black and white T-shirts.
Look for the drop to hit on March 31.
